DIY-ABLE HEADBOARD IDEAS

HERE ARE A FEW UNIQUE HEADBOARDS THAT YOU CAN MAKE YOURSELF~VERY INEXPENSIVELY!
USE OLD SHUTTERS..... A BOOKSHELF....

LOVE THIS ONE.....USE
THESE FRAMES.......
THEY ARE THE ONES I HAVE OVER MY BED.
YOU COULD DO THIS WHOLE LOOK FOR UNDER $200.00!

HAVE A GARDEN THEMED ROOM? HEAD TO HOME DEPOT AND GET SOME PICKET FENCING!

I LOVE THIS ONE USING OLD DOORS......RECYCLING AT IT'S BEST!


THIS ONE AGAIN USES DOORS. THE CHEAP HOLLOW CORE DOORS YOU CAN THROW LIKE A FRISBEE! TURN THEM ON THEIR SIDE AND PAINT THEM OUT! VIOLA!
I THINK THIS WOULD BE GREAT USING CHALKBOARD PAINT SO YOU CAN WRITE THINGS LIKE "NOT TONIGHT" HA-HA!
